Air enters a compressor operating at steady state at \(50^{\circ} \mathrm{C}\), 0.9 bar, 70% relative humidity with a volumetric flow rate of 0.8 \(\mathrm{m}^{3} / \mathrm{s}\). The moist air exits the compressor at \(195^{\circ} \mathrm{C}\), 1.5 bar. Assuming the compressor is well insulated, determine

(a) the relative humidity at the exit.

(b) the power input, in kW.

(c) the rate of entropy production, in kW/K.
